Output 8086d36b86355ee4c23cfde232ebbb7c915ea35b4ce65b5416c975c7b1ffdec2:0

value
8575296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ac27fc18abb10c0ca7aed81b8339a65206a8d2a1 OP_EQUAL
address
3HPJ3jAeKjbmSbkVpi8xY9G8uQxxRxnByC
transaction
8086d36b86355ee4c23cfde232ebbb7c915ea35b4ce65b5416c975c7b1ffdec2
spent
true